Understanding the Vacuum Hose in a Supercharger System

The vacuum hose connects various components of the supercharger system, including the boost control solenoid, wastegate, and intake manifold. It carries vacuum pressure that helps regulate boost levels and control airflow. Over time, these hoses can become brittle, cracked, or disconnected, leading to performance issues or engine warning lights.

Signs of a Faulty Vacuum Hose

  • Unusual engine noises or hissing sounds
  • Decreased engine performance or power loss
  • Check engine light activation
  • Poor fuel economy
  • Visible cracks or damage on the hose

Inspection Procedure

To inspect the vacuum hoses, follow these steps:

  • Ensure the engine is cool before starting.
  • Locate the vacuum hoses connected to the supercharger and related components.
  • Visually check for cracks, splits, or signs of wear.
  • Gently squeeze the hoses to feel for brittleness or soft spots.
  • Ensure all connections are tight and secure.

Replacement Process

If any hoses show signs of damage or wear, replacement is necessary. Follow these steps:

  • Gather the correct replacement hoses specified for your vehicle.
  • Disconnect the damaged hose by loosening clamps or fittings.
  • Remove the old hose carefully, noting its routing.
  • Attach the new hose, ensuring it is seated properly on all connections.
  • Secure clamps tightly to prevent leaks.
  • Start the engine and check for leaks or abnormal noises.
